DRIVER SERVICE (DAILY COMMUTE) is a federal award for Department of Defense (DOD) held by Sanyu-Shoji Co.., Ltd. Estimated value $465K ($465K obligated). Current period of performance ends Jul 31, 2024. Related solicitation HE125422R2003.
